L’SQL Like viene utilizzato quando vogliamo restituire la riga se una stringa di caratteri specifica corrisponde a un modello specificato. Il modello può essere una combinazione di caratteri normali e caratteri jolly. Per restituire una riga indietro, i caratteri normali devono corrispondere esattamente ai caratteri specificati nella stringa di caratteri.
Quando dovrei usare like in SQL?
L’SQL Like viene utilizzato quando vogliamo restituire la riga se una stringa di caratteri specifica corrisponde a un modello specificato. Il modello può essere una combinazione di caratteri normali e caratteri jolly. Per restituire una riga indietro, i caratteri regolari devono corrispondere esattamente ai caratteri specificati nella stringa di caratteri.
Puoi usare come in SQL?
L’operatore LIKE viene utilizzato in una clausola WHERE per cercare un modello specificato in una colonna. Ci sono due caratteri jolly usati spesso insieme all’operatore LIKE: Il segno di percentuale (%) rappresenta zero, uno o più caratteri. Il segno di sottolineatura (_) rappresenta un singolo carattere.
Perché usare like invece che in SQL?
LIKE è ciò che useresti in una query di ricerca. Permette anche caratteri jolly come _ (carattere jolly semplice) e % (carattere jolly multi-carattere). = dovrebbe essere usato se vuoi corrispondenze esatte e sarà più veloce.
Quando dovrei usare like in SQL?
L’SQL Like viene utilizzato quando vogliamo restituire la riga se una stringa di caratteri specifica corrisponde a un modello specificato. Il modello può essere una combinazione di caratteri normali e caratteri jolly. Per restituire una riga indietro, i caratteri regolari devono corrispondere esattamente ai caratteri specificati nella stringa di caratteri.
Puoi usare come in SQL?
L’operatore LIKE viene utilizzato in una clausola WHERE per cercare un modello specificato in una colonna. Ci sono due caratteri jolly spesso usati insieme all’operatore LIKE: Il segno di percentuale (%)rappresenta zero, uno o più caratteri. Il segno di sottolineatura (_) rappresenta un singolo carattere.
È più veloce che in SQL?
1 risposta. L’utilizzo dell’operatore ‘=’ è più veloce dell’operatore LIKE nel confronto delle stringhe perché l’operatore ‘=’ confronta l’intera stringa ma la parola chiave LIKE confronta ogni carattere della stringa.
Qual è la differenza tra simile e uguale a in SQL?
Oltre alla differenza di avere caratteri jolly, % e _, c’è una differenza significativa tra gli operatori LIKE e = è che l’operatore LIKE non ignora gli spazi finali mentre l’operatore = ignora gli spazi finali.
Come in SQL non fa distinzione tra maiuscole e minuscole?
LIKE esegue corrispondenze di sottostringhe senza distinzione tra maiuscole e minuscole se le regole di confronto per l’espressione e il modello non fanno distinzione tra maiuscole e minuscole. Per le corrispondenze con distinzione tra maiuscole e minuscole, dichiara uno degli argomenti per utilizzare un confronto binario utilizzando COLLATE , oppure forza uno di essi in una stringa BINARY utilizzando CAST .
Ti piace lavorare in MySQL?
Ilike funziona in MySQL? È in PostgreSQL che la parola chiave ILIKE può essere utilizzata al posto di LIKE per rendere la corrispondenza senza distinzione tra maiuscole e minuscole in base alla locale attiva. Questo non è nello standard SQL ma è un’estensione PostgreSQL. In MySQL non hai ILIKE.
Possiamo usare like in SOQL?
Quando si utilizza LIKE per trovare una corrispondenza con un termine di ricerca in SOQL che include un carattere riservato come un trattino basso, in Apex code, sarà necessario eseguire ulteriori passaggi per ottenere i risultati previsti. Questo test esegue l’escape del carattere di sottolineatura.
SQL è altrettanto efficiente?
L’operatore SQL LIKE molto spesso causa prestazioni impreviste perché alcuni termini di ricerca impediscono un utilizzo efficiente dell’indice. Ciò significa che ci sono termini di ricerca che possono essere indicizzati molto bene, ma altri no.
Dovrei usare like o asse?
Se è una congiunzione, usa as. Se è una preposizione, chiediti se il significato è simile o uguale a. Se è simile a, usa like.
DOVE usiamo like?
Like come preposizione che significa ‘simile a’ Sembra un uomo simpatico. Quando usiamo like per indicare ‘simile a’, possiamo mettere parole e frasi come un po’, solo, molto, così e altro prima di parlare del grado di somiglianza: è un po’ come sciare ma non c’è neve.
Come si sostituisce il mi piace?
Per fortuna, ci sono molte parole di riempimento che puoi usare senza lo stigma. Al posto di “mi piace”, prova “per esempio”, “dici”, “quasi” o “circa”. Alla fine, potresti voler correggere del tutto le parole aggiuntive, ma per ora usa queste parole come una stampella per smettere di usare “mi piace”.
Puoi usare not like in MySQL?
L’operatore NOT LIKE in MySQL è usato per il pattern matching. Confronta la colonna in base al valore specificato e restituisce il risultato che non corrisponde al valore nella clausola NOT LIKE. Se l’istruzione trova la corrispondenza, restituirà 0.
Posso usare Mi piace in data?
L’operatore Like non funzionerà con DateTime.
Possiamo usare like e not like in SQL?
Gli operatori SQL LIKE e NOT LIKE vengono utilizzati per trovare corrispondenze tra una stringa e un determinato pattern. Fanno parte di SQL standard e funzionano su tutti i tipi di database, rendendola una conoscenza essenziale per tutti gli utenti SQL.
Posso usare Mi piace in data?
L’operatore Like non funzionerà con DateTime.
Quando dovrei usare like in SQL?
L’SQL Like viene utilizzato quando vogliamo restituire la riga se una stringa di caratteri specifica corrisponde a un modello specificato. Il modello può essere una combinazione di caratteri normali e caratteri jolly. Per restituire una riga indietro, i caratteri regolari devono corrispondere esattamente ai caratteri specificati nel caratterestringa.
Puoi usare come in SQL?
L’operatore LIKE viene utilizzato in una clausola WHERE per cercare un modello specificato in una colonna. Ci sono due caratteri jolly usati spesso insieme all’operatore LIKE: Il segno di percentuale (%) rappresenta zero, uno o più caratteri. Il segno di sottolineatura (_) rappresenta un singolo carattere.
Le query simili utilizzano l’indice?
Un indice non velocizzerebbe la query, perché per le colonne testuali gli indici funzionano indicizzando N caratteri partendo da sinistra. Quando fai LIKE ‘%text%’ non può usare l’indice perché può esserci un numero variabile di caratteri prima del testo.